| #Variable declaration | |
| $vCenterIPorFQDN="192.168.243.172" | |
| $vCenterUsername="Administrator@vsphere.local" | |
| $vCenterPassword="vmware" | |
| $pathToVcloudAgent="/opt/vmware/vcloud-director/agent" #Path of vCloud Agent in vCloud Director virtual machine | |
| $FileVcloudAgent="vcloudagent-esx51-5.1.0-799577.zip" #vCloud Agent file that will be installed | |
| $downloadDestination="C:\Users\Paolo\Desktop" #Where to download vCloud Agent on local machine | |
| $vCdVmName="vCloud Director" #Name of vCloud Director virtual machine | |
| $vCdVmUsername="root" #vCloud Director virtual machine username | |
| $vCdVmPassword="vmware" #vCloud Director virtual machine password | |
| $InstallHosts= @("192.168.243.144") #IP or FQDN of ESXi hosts on which vcloud agent will be installed | |
| $HostUsername="root" #This assumes every host in both clusters have same user/password | |
| $HostPassword="mypassword" | |
| $puttyScpLocation='C:\Users\Paolo\Downloads\pscp.exe' #Location of pscp.exe (Putty Secure Copy) executable - Please preserve single quotes | |
| Write-Host "Connecting to vCenter" -foregroundcolor "magenta" | |
| Connect-VIServer -Server $vCenterIPorFQDN -Username $vCenterUsername -Password $vCenterPassword | |
| #Get new vCloud agent downloading it from the vCloud Director VM | |
| Write-Host "Downloading" $FileVcloudAgent "to your local machine in" $downloadDestination "directory" -foregroundcolor "magenta" | |
| Copy-VMGuestFile -Source "$($pathToVcloudAgent)/$($FileVcloudAgent)" -Destination $downloadDestination -VM $vCdVmName -GuestToLocal -GuestUser $vCdVmUsername -GuestPassword $vCdVmPassword | |
| foreach ($element in $InstallHosts) { | |
| #Set Host into Maintenance Mode | |
| Write-Host "Entering maintenance mode" -foregroundcolor "magenta" | |
| Get-VMHost -Name $element | Set-VMHost -State Maintenance | |
| #Start SSH service on host in order to allow the copy of vcloud agent using Secure Copy | |
| Start-VMHostService -HostService (Get-VMHostService -VMHost $element | Where-Object Label -eq "SSH") -Confirm:$false | |
| #Check whether vcloud agent is installed or not | |
| $esx=Get-EsxCli -VMHost $element | |
| $isAlreadeyInstalled = $esx.software.vib.list($true) | Where-Object Name -like "vcloud-agent" | Select-Object Version | |
| if ($isAlreadeyInstalled.Version -eq $null) { #No previous agent on host. | |
| Write-Host "No vCloud agent found, proceeding to installation" -foregroundcolor "magenta" | |
| }else{ #Uninstall previous agent | |
| Write-Host "vCloud agent found. Let me uninstall it before proceeding" -foregroundcolor "magenta" | |
| $esx.software.vib.remove($false,$false,$true,$false,"vcloud-agent") | |
| } | |
| #Transfer vcloud agent over to ESXi host using Putty Secure Copy | |
| Write-Host "Copying vCloud agent over to ESXi host" -foregroundcolor "magenta" | |
| & $puttyScpLocation -pw $HostPassword "$($downloadDestination)\$($FileVcloudAgent)" "$($HostUsername)@$($element):/tmp" | |
| #Install vcloud agent | |
| Write-Host "Installing vCloud agent" -foregroundcolor "magenta" | |
| $esx.software.vib.install("/tmp/$($FileVcloudAgent)", $false, $false, $true, $false, $false) | |
| #Stop SSH service on host | |
| Stop-VMHostService -HostService (Get-VMHostService -VMHost $element | Where-Object Label -eq "SSH") -Confirm:$false | |
| #Exit Maintenance Mode | |
| Write-Host "Exiting maintenance mode" -foregroundcolor "magenta" | |
| Get-VMHost -Name $element | Set-VMHost -State Connected | |
| } |
